Major Updates in NCERT Textbooks: Key Revisions for Classes 3, 6, and More

As 2024 concludes, India’s academic reforms take middle stage with important updates to NCERT textbooks. These revisions, aligned with the National Education Policy (NEP) 2020, purpose to modernize the curriculum and cut back the tutorial burden on college students. The changes span a number of topics, together with historical past, political science, and science, and are set to impression college students and educators within the upcoming tutorial yr.
While these updates have been welcomed as progressive by some, others have raised issues concerning their ideological implications. The modifications additionally embody changes to the supply of recent supplies and structured applications to facilitate a easy transition to the up to date curriculum.
New Textbooks for Specific Classes
Introduction of New Syllabus: NCERT launched new textbooks for Classes 3 and 6 in April and May 2024, marking an important milestone in curriculum revamps. For Class 3, the up to date textbooks emphasize experiential studying with exercise-primarily based content material in arithmetic and environmental research. The Class 6 revisions embody the addition of coding fundamentals in laptop science and an enhanced give attention to Indian heritage in social sciences. These updates align with NEP-2020, supporting the transition from foundational to center-stage schooling.
No Changes for Other Classes: No updates have been made for Classes 1, 2, 4, 5, 9, and 11 for the 2024–25 tutorial yr. Schools will proceed to make use of the textbooks from the earlier yr for these grades.
Curriculum Rationalization and Content Updates
Rationalization Efforts: Initiated in 2021–2022, the rationalization course of aimed to cut back the syllabus load, specializing in supporting college students’ psychological well being post-Covid 19 and making a extra manageable curriculum.
Updates in Science Curriculum: One of essentially the most debated changes within the science curriculum is the elimination of the periodic desk from the Class 9 syllabus. Critics argue that this shift compromises foundational scientific schooling, whereas NCERT asserts that the subject has been moved to Class 11 for higher alignment with studying levels.
Revisions in History and Political Science Textbooks
Alterations to Historical Content: The revised historical past textbooks have undergone substantial changes. References to the Babri Masjid have been changed with the time period “three-domed structure.” Content concerning the BJP’s ‘rath yatra,’ communal violence, and the following political fallout has additionally been omitted.
Changes in Mughal History: A desk summarizing the achievements of distinguished Mughal emperors reminiscent of Akbar, Shah Jahan, and Aurangzeb has been eliminated. This has sparked criticism concerning the exclusion of serious historic narratives that contribute to a nuanced understanding of India’s previous.
New Terminologies and Perspectives: The time period “classical history” has changed “ancient history” in social science textbooks. Additionally, proposals to interchange ‘India’ with ‘Bharat’ in textbooks are into consideration, aligning with constitutional terminology.
Political Science Revisions: The revised Class 11 political science textbooks now state that political events usually prioritize “minority appeasement” for “vote bank politics.” This change has been criticized for introducing doubtlessly contentious political beliefs into tutorial content material.
Implementation Timeline and Availability
Rollout of New Materials: The revised textbooks for Classes 3 and 6 have been launched in phases, with Classes 3 supplies out there from April 2024 and Class 6 from May 2024. The updates for different grades are anticipated in subsequent tutorial years.
Bridge Programs for Educators: To facilitate the transition to the brand new curriculum, NCERT has launched “Bridge Programmes.” These applications purpose to arrange educators in CBSE, Kendriya Vidyalaya Sangathan (KVS), and Navodaya Vidyalaya Samiti (NVS) faculties for brand spanking new pedagogical strategies, making certain easy implementation.
Support and Criticism
While these changes replicate efforts to modernize schooling and align it with world requirements, they haven’t been with out controversy. The elimination of particular content material, notably in historical past and science, has sparked debates in regards to the objectivity and inclusiveness of the curriculum. Supporters argue that these revisions are obligatory for lowering redundancy and fostering a sharper give attention to important subjects.
The yr 2024 has been transformative for NCERT textbooks, with these updates poised to affect the schooling system considerably. The upcoming tutorial yr will function a litmus check for the efficacy and reception of those changes in lecture rooms throughout the nation.
